Overview

The reaction program button is an industrial-grade input device designed for process control applications. Unlike standard pushbuttons, it interfaces with programmable logic controllers (PLCs) or distributed control systems (DCS) to execute complex reaction sequences with a single press. These components are critical in chemical plants, manufacturing lines, and power generation facilities where rapid, reliable sequence initiation is required. Modern versions incorporate smart features like press-force adjustment, multi-stage activation, and wireless connectivity options. Their design prioritizes fail-safe operation, often including redundant contacts and mechanical interlocks to prevent accidental activation. The buttons are typically rated for 24V DC to 240V AC operation, with high-end models supporting PROFIBUS or Ethernet/IP communication protocols.

Structure and Working Principle

A standard reaction program button consists of three main components: the actuator (button cap), the switching mechanism, and the housing. The actuator is usually color-coded (red for emergency stops, yellow for cautionary sequences) and may include tactile or audible feedback. The switching mechanism employs gold-plated contacts for reliable operation, rated for 0.1-5A current loads. Internally, the button connects to control systems through normally open (NO) or normally closed (NC) contacts. Advanced models feature dual-circuit designs where the first press arms the system and the second confirms execution. Some incorporate time-delay relays or password protection to prevent unauthorized use. The housing meets IP65-67 ingress protection standards, with stainless steel versions available for corrosive environments.

Key Features

Reaction program buttons distinguish themselves through several industrial-grade characteristics. They offer high mechanical durability, with lifespan ratings from 50,000 to over 1 million operations depending on the model. The contact materials are selected for low resistance and arc suppression, often using silver-nickel or silver-cadmium alloys. Modern iterations include integrated diagnostics - LED indicators display system readiness (green), activation confirmation (blue), and fault states (red). Some feature built-in RFID tags for maintenance tracking. Environmental resilience is another hallmark, with operating temperature ranges typically spanning -30°C to +70°C. Specialized versions offer explosion-proof certifications (ATEX, IECEx) for hazardous locations.

Application Areas

These buttons are indispensable in industries requiring sequenced reactions. In chemical processing, they initiate catalyst injection or emergency venting procedures. Pharmaceutical manufacturers use them for sterile line changeovers. Energy sector applications include turbine startup sequences and grid synchronization protocols. Food-grade variants (FDA-compliant materials) control CIP (Clean-in-Place) cycles in beverage plants. Automotive assembly lines employ them for robotic cell reset commands. The marine industry utilizes waterproof models with galvanic corrosion protection for shipboard systems. Emerging applications include laboratory automation and semiconductor fabrication cleanrooms.

Maintenance and Precautions

Proper maintenance ensures reliable operation throughout the button's service life. Quarterly inspections should check for contact erosion (replace if exceeding 50% material loss) and actuator free-play (shouldn't exceed 0.5mm). Contact cleaners specifically formulated for electrical components can remove oxidation without damaging the surface finish. Critical precautions include verifying the load compatibility - inductive loads (solenoids, contactors) require derating by 20-30% compared to resistive ratings. Installations in high-vibration environments need anti-loosening measures like thread-locking compounds. For safety-critical applications, redundant buttons in series/parallel configurations are recommended. Always follow lockout-tagout (LOTO) procedures during maintenance.

B2B Procurement Guide

When sourcing reaction program buttons, prioritize suppliers with industry-specific expertise. Request certifications like UL 508, IEC 60947-5-1, or EN 13849 for safety compliance. For batch orders, ask about customization options - legends, custom colors, or special actuator shapes (mushroom, flush, extended). Lead times vary significantly: standard models (2-4 weeks), customized (6-8 weeks), explosion-proof (10-12 weeks). Consider total cost of ownership - high-quality contacts may cost 20-30% more but last 3-5x longer. For global operations, verify RoHS, REACH, and conflict mineral compliance. Some manufacturers offer lifecycle services including contact refurbishment and firmware updates for smart buttons.
